Break-glass: Relayline websocket reconnect bug

Status for eng sync: clients on Relayline v3 reconnect in a tight loop after idle timeout, flooding the Harborpoint gateway. Mitigation: raise the backoff cap to 120s via the emergency config channel. That channel is break-glass only — use it solely if the gateway error rate exceeds 5%. Log every use in the incident doc. Access is gated by the sealed ops vault, which opens with the recovery passphrase below.

unlock words, yagep-fahof: belix-rusvan-casdor-gorox-aldath-norael-istix-quenael-fraeth-silael

The Quellstone planner regression (v4.2) causes nested joins to skip index hints. Workaround: pin the planner to legacy mode via the optimizer flag until the fix ships. Repro steps live in the Brindlewood test suite. To run those tests locally you need the staging database credential, which the next line sets.

vault entry, kafog-yahop: COURIER_KEY8=0faa53ae

**Ticket: Config drift on ConsentCrest banner rollout**

During the phased rollout of the ConsentCrest banner across Bramleaf properties, we found that the staging and production tiers have diverged. Staging picked up the new region-detection flags two sprints ago, but production is still on the old defaults, which means the banner variant shipped to Veldham users differs from what QA signed off on. This needs reconciliation before the next release train leaves. For reference, the values production should converge to are as follows.

deployment values, faduf-tawep:
SORDOR_LOG_LEVEL=error
SORDOR_METRICS_HOST=metrics.sordor.nelvrolabs.internal
SORDOR_POOL_SIZE=4

Handover — Vexler partner SFTP drop

Ownership moves to you today. Drop runs hourly from Vexler's end into the intake bucket via the relay host. Watch for zero-byte files; their exporter flakes on Mondays. Creds live in the ops vault, path noted in the runbook. Vault auto-seals after 48h idle. Support escalations go to the on-call rotation, not me. If the vault is sealed when you need it, unseal with the recovery passphrase below.

recovery phrase for tadug-fafof: zorwyn-kasion